Output 51758d65e31dab186ec070392660471dd2e2f27d9e7f34da4ded972997509c55:3

value
19739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a52dd69925d253272831cc4b4035dbdef88ef1 OP_EQUAL
address
3E9XhUV6uEHXoS8rcCAE5MuRqAi78BP6jT
transaction
51758d65e31dab186ec070392660471dd2e2f27d9e7f34da4ded972997509c55